When a horse is young, its body produces substantial amounts of collagen. As vital as collagen protein is to a horse's vitality and well-being its body's capacity to produce it declines with age. Collagen depletion is a natural part of every animal's ageing process and results in visible and degenerative signs of ageing. Lost collagen results in deteriorating bone health which can cause mobility issues, discomfort, pain and a whole host of other comorbidities including autoimmune disorders. In older animals, the daily intake of protein can be suboptimal and contribute to joint stiffness, arthritis and osteoporosis, a condition where bone mineral density is low. Low bone mineral density (BMD) is associated with bone instability, weakness, discomfort and increased fracture risks, commonly in the spine, shoulder and hip.

Type I collagen represents 90% of organic bone mass. Bones comprise living and dead cells embedded in the extracellular matrix that makes up the skeleton. These cells are continually remodelling or turning over to build new bone. Bones are essentially brittle; their collagen protein gives bones flexibility and tensile strength, joint function, comfort and mobility. Like other connective tissue, bone is metabolically active throughout life. Bone health becomes vitally important with increased age as the balance between bone resorption and formation becomes compromised by a net loss of bone tissues. Research shows that a daily intake of collagen stimulates osteoblasts, the cells responsible for bone formation. Osteoblasts support healthy bone metabolism, preserve bone strength and restore bone mineral density, helping to offset the degenerative effects of ageing to keep horses and ponies active for life.
